Safely volunteer your time.
Last spring, many local nonprofits who traditionally rely heavily on volunteers to carry out their programs had to scale back their volunteer opportunities in order to ensure safe conditions for both volunteers and those they serve. So, they strategized about how to keep everyone safe, meanwhile still carrying out their missions and serving the communities that need it most. They added virtual volunteer opportunities. They took fundraising events online. They provided PPE, and in smaller groups, adapt they did. Now, there are so many ways to get our and volunteer your time to the organizations here in Portland that put this community on their backs, not just during crazy COVID times, but all the time. So, whatever causes that you support, see how you can help. And, if you don’t know where to start, check out Hands On Greater Portland to find opportunities near you.
Shop local.
You’ve heard this one before. But, there’s a good reason! Voting with your dollar is one of the most impactful ways that you can show your support for Portland businesses. One of the many great things about this quirky and vibrant city is that most things that you could be shopping for, you can get locally. Local organizations like the Portland Business Alliance, Prosper Portland, and Travel Oregon have made it easy search and figure out exactly how to support your favorite businesses, and even find new favorites by category with initiatives like ShopSmallPDX and Here for Portland.
Show your favorite organizations some love.
Whether it’s your favorite coffee shop down the road, your barber, or a nonprofit whose mission really hits home for you, you can show your support in ways that won’t cost you a dime. Recommend them to a friend, even through social media. Leave a review on Google, Yelp, or their website. If they ask for your feedback, let them know you love them! You can even write a #PDXloveletter to your favorite places, if you want to! Be it an all-out letter or just a five-star rating, even the smallest gestures add up.
